生产管理用什么数据库
-
在生产管理中,可以使用多种不同类型的数据库来支持数据存储和管理。以下是几种常见的数据库类型:
-
关系型数据库:关系型数据库是最常见和广泛使用的数据库类型之一。它们使用表格和关系来组织和存储数据,并使用SQL(Structured Query Language)进行查询和操作。常见的关系型数据库包括MySQL、Oracle、SQL Server等。
-
非关系型数据库:非关系型数据库,也被称为NoSQL数据库,不使用表格和关系来存储数据,而是使用其他数据结构,如键值对、文档、列族等。非关系型数据库通常用于处理大量非结构化或半结构化数据。常见的非关系型数据库包括MongoDB、Cassandra、Redis等。
-
内存数据库:内存数据库将数据存储在内存中,以提供更快的读写速度。它们通常用于需要高性能和低延迟的应用程序,如实时数据分析、缓存等。常见的内存数据库包括Redis、Memcached等。
-
图数据库:图数据库使用图形结构来存储和处理数据,适用于需要处理复杂的关系和网络连接的应用程序,如社交网络分析、推荐系统等。常见的图数据库包括Neo4j、ArangoDB等。
-
时间序列数据库:时间序列数据库专门用于存储和处理时间序列数据,如传感器数据、日志数据等。它们具有高效的数据写入和查询能力,适用于需要大规模处理时间序列数据的应用程序。常见的时间序列数据库包括InfluxDB、OpenTSDB等。
选择适合的数据库取决于生产管理的具体需求和要求。需要考虑的因素包括数据规模、数据结构、读写性能、数据一致性要求、安全性、可扩展性等。同时,还需要考虑数据库的成本、易用性、可维护性等方面。综合考虑这些因素,选择最合适的数据库可以提高生产管理的效率和性能。
1年前 -
-
生产管理可以使用多种类型的数据库,具体选择哪种数据库取决于需求和实际情况。以下是几种常见的数据库类型:
-
关系型数据库(RDBMS):关系型数据库是最常见的数据库类型之一,具有强大的数据存储和管理能力。常见的关系型数据库包括MySQL、Oracle、SQL Server等。关系型数据库使用表和行的结构来组织数据,通过SQL语言来进行数据操作和查询。它们适用于需要高度结构化和复杂关联的数据管理,如生产计划、物料管理和质量控制等。
-
非关系型数据库(NoSQL):非关系型数据库是一类不使用传统的表格关系型结构来组织数据的数据库。它们适用于大规模、高并发的数据存储和管理,可以处理非结构化和半结构化数据。常见的非关系型数据库包括MongoDB、Cassandra、Redis等。非关系型数据库在生产管理中可以用于存储日志数据、传感器数据和实时监控数据等。
-
内存数据库:内存数据库将数据存储在内存中,而不是硬盘上。它们具有高速读写和低延迟的特点,适用于需要快速处理大量数据的应用场景。常见的内存数据库有Redis、Memcached等。内存数据库在生产管理中可以用于实时数据分析、缓存和高速数据查询等。
-
时间序列数据库:时间序列数据库专门用于存储和处理时间相关的数据,如传感器数据、日志数据和时序数据等。时间序列数据库具有高效的数据插入和查询性能,并提供了丰富的时间序列数据处理功能。常见的时间序列数据库有InfluxDB、OpenTSDB等。时间序列数据库在生产管理中可以用于监控数据存储和分析、故障诊断和预测等。
综上所述,选择适合的数据库取决于生产管理的具体需求和数据特点。根据数据的结构、规模、访问模式和性能要求等因素,可以选择关系型数据库、非关系型数据库、内存数据库或时间序列数据库等。
1年前 -
-
生产管理可以使用多种数据库来存储和管理数据,常见的数据库包括关系型数据库和非关系型数据库。下面将介绍几种常用的数据库。
- 关系型数据库(RDBMS)
关系型数据库是一种基于关系模型的数据库,使用表格(即关系)来组织数据,表格由行和列组成,行表示记录,列表示字段。关系型数据库具有结构化、严格的数据模型,支持事务处理和SQL查询语言,适合存储结构化数据和需要复杂查询的应用。
常见的关系型数据库包括:
- MySQL:MySQL是一种开源的关系型数据库管理系统,具有高性能和可扩展性,广泛应用于Web应用程序和企业级应用。
- Oracle:Oracle是一种功能强大的关系型数据库管理系统,具有高可用性和可扩展性,适用于大型企业级应用。
- SQL Server:SQL Server是微软开发的关系型数据库管理系统,适用于Windows平台,具有良好的性能和可靠性。
- P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,具有丰富的功能和扩展性,适用于复杂的数据模型和高并发访问。
- 非关系型数据库(NoSQL)
非关系型数据库是一种不使用传统的表格结构来存储数据的数据库,它以键值对、文档、列族等方式组织数据。非关系型数据库具有高可扩展性、高性能和灵活的数据模型,适合存储大规模、非结构化或半结构化数据。
常见的非关系型数据库包括:
- MongoDB:MongoDB是一种面向文档的非关系型数据库,以JSON风格的文档存储数据,支持复杂查询和水平扩展。
- Cassandra:Cassandra是一种分布式的非关系型数据库,具有高可扩展性和高性能,适用于大规模的分布式数据存储和处理。
- Redis:Redis是一种基于内存的非关系型数据库,支持键值对和多种数据结构,适用于高速读写和缓存。
选择适合的数据库需要根据具体的需求和应用场景来决定,包括数据规模、性能要求、数据结构和查询需求等。此外,还要考虑数据库的稳定性、可靠性和维护成本等因素。
1年前 - 关系型数据库(RDBMS)